Video blocked EMMANUELLE IN SPACE: A LESSON IN LOVE Movie Review (1994) Schlockmeisters #732

EMMANUELLE IN SPACE: A LESSON IN LOVE Movie Review (1994) Schlockmeisters #732

Similar videos